When two air masses meet and neither is displaced, what kind of front is present?
warm |
|
cold |
|
stationary |
|
occluded |
When two air masses meet and neither is displaced, a stationary front is created. Stationary fronts often cause persistent cloudy wet weather.

Vector quantities are fully described by which of the following?
a magnitude and a direction |
|
a magnitude only |
|
a direction and a polarity |
|
a direction only |
Velocity and displacement are vector quantities which means each is fully described by both a magnitude and a direction. In contrast, scalar quantities are quantities that are fully described by a magnitude only. A variable indicating a vector quantity will often be shown with an arrow symbol: \(\vec{v}\)
A biological community of interacting organisms and their physical environment is known as:
biome |
|
ecosystem |
|
population |
|
community |
An ecosystem is a biological community of interacting organisms and their physical environment. This includes both the biotic (living) and abiotic (non-living).
